Inclusion Criteria
Students regularly enrolled in the eighth period of the course in Nursing in Adult and Elderly Health II; with a minimum age of 18 years; both genders
Exclusion Criteria
Students who were not attending the course, due to withdrawal from enrollment or leave of any nature; students who dropped out or who did not take the immediate post-test
